Martin Truex Jr. Slams ‘Ridiculous’ Racing Tactics After Late-Race Drama at Watkins Glen

US

Martin Truex Jr. has voiced his frustration over what he describes as “ridiculous” racing tactics following a chaotic conclusion to the race at Watkins Glen International on Sunday. After finishing P20, his best result in over two months, Truex was less than complimentary of 2021 champion Kyle Larson, especially during the late-race restarts.

Truex, who has seen his performance decline since July despite a strong start to the 2024 season, now faces a big challenge: he must secure at least a top 5 finish in the final race of the round to ensure his spot in the Round of 12 for the NASCAR playoffs. There is an urgency for him to perform well, and a pressure on his shoulders.

Drama at Watkins Glen erupted during the closing laps of the race. For Truex, these final moments were marred by aggressive driving, particularly from Larson.

The No.5 Chevrolet driver’s tactics not only impeded Truex’s momentum but also resulted in multiple incidents where Truex found himself being driven through by other cars.

In the aftermath, the New Jersey driver did not hold back his frustration.

“It’s just crazy that all these races always come down to this. I don’t really understand how guys can call themselves the best in the world when they just drive through everyone on restarts at the end of these races. It’s very frustrating but it is what it is these days, so I’m out of here,” Truex told NBC, via First Sportz.

His continued:

“You get green-white-checkered at the end of the race, and you know people are just going to drive through someone. We were on the wrong lane, on the short end of the stick as usual.

“We were in a decent spot there with our Reser’s Camry, and you go through the esses, and they just plow through you and put you in the marbles. This racing is just ridiculous,” he said.

As Truex looks ahead to the final race of the round, there is substantial pressure on his shoulders. Securing a top 5 finish is now imperative if he hopes to advance in the playoffs, making his performance in the upcoming race critical for his championship aspirations.
